$117K Is Average Teacher Salary In Lower Merion School District: Niche

Data compiler Niche reported the average Lower Merion School District teacher salary is upwards of $117,000. See details here.

LOWER MERION TOWNSHIP, PA — The Lower Merion School District is one of the best places to be a teacher in the state, according to Niche.

Data compiler Niche recently released its list of the best places to teach in Pennsylvania.

Ranking factors included teacher salaries, teacher tenure, teacher absenteeism, student-teacher ratio, as well as the district's Niche grades for Overall, Administration, Safety, and Resources.

The Lower Merion School District was ranked No. 8 for the best places to teach in the state.

And, Niche ranked the district at No. 19 among districts with the best teachers in Pennsylvania.

Patch recently reported the district was ranked fourth among all public school districts in Pennsylvania by Niche.

According to Niche, the average teacher salary at the district is $117,364.

Nearby, the average teacher salary at the School District of Haverford Township is $93,137.

The highest teacher salary in the state is at Council Rock School District, where the average instructor makes $122,000 a year, according to Niche.
